Product Overview

Honeywell MU-TAOY22 80366481-125 — Dual-Channel 4–20 mA Analog Output Module for TotalPlant Solution DCS

The MU-TAOY22 (factory part number 80366481-125) is a two-channel analog output module designed for deployment within Honeywell’s TotalPlant Solution (TPS) and TDC 3000 Distributed Control System architecture. Each channel drives a 4–20 mA current loop to field actuators, control valves, and variable-speed drives, providing the process controller with a deterministic, low-impedance signal path that is immune to resistive voltage drops across long cable runs. The module occupies a single card slot in the High-Performance Process Manager (HPM) or Advanced Process Manager (APM) chassis and communicates with the controller over the internal I/O Link bus at a fixed 2 Mbps token-passing rate, ensuring output updates are delivered within one controller scan cycle.

Unlike voltage-mode output cards, the current-loop architecture of the MU-TAOY22 maintains signal integrity across field cable resistances up to 750 Ω per channel, making it suitable for installations where field junction boxes are located hundreds of metres from the marshalling cabinet. The module’s internal digital-to-analog converter (DAC) operates at 12-bit resolution, yielding a theoretical step size of approximately 3.9 µA across the 16 mA span — sufficient for valve positioning applications requiring sub-0.1% full-scale accuracy.

Technical Parameters

Parameter Specification
Part Number MU-TAOY22 / 80366481-125
Manufacturer Honeywell Process Solutions
Compatible Platform TotalPlant Solution (TPS) / TDC 3000 — HPM, APM
Module Function Analog Output
Number of Output Channels 2 (independent, isolated)
Output Signal Type 4–20 mA current loop (sourcing)
DAC Resolution 12-bit
Output Accuracy ±0.1% of full scale at 25 °C
Maximum Load Resistance 750 Ω per channel
Channel-to-Channel Isolation Optocoupler-based galvanic isolation
I/O Bus Interface TPS I/O Link, 2 Mbps token-passing
Backplane Power Consumption ≤ 3.5 W (from HPM/APM backplane)
Operating Temperature 0 °C to +60 °C
Storage Temperature −40 °C to +85 °C
Relative Humidity 5% to 95% non-condensing
Form Factor Standard TPS single-width card module
Approx. Weight 420 g
Regulatory Compliance CE, RoHS
Warranty 12 months from date of shipment

Hardware Logical Analysis

The MU-TAOY22 implements per-channel galvanic isolation through optocoupler barriers positioned between the digital logic domain (backplane side) and the analog output stage (field side). This topology prevents ground-loop currents — a common failure mode in multi-drop 4–20 mA installations — from propagating into the controller backplane and corrupting adjacent I/O channels. The isolation barrier is rated to withstand transient voltages consistent with IEC 61000-4-5 surge immunity requirements, providing protection against inductive switching transients generated by solenoid valves and motor contactors sharing the same field cable tray.

On the digital side, the module’s local microcontroller receives output setpoint data from the HPM/APM processor over the I/O Link bus and writes the corresponding 12-bit word to the DAC latch. The DAC output feeds a voltage-to-current converter (V/I stage) built around a precision op-amp with a low-drift reference, maintaining output accuracy across the full operating temperature range without requiring field calibration. A hardware watchdog circuit monitors the I/O Link communication frame; if no valid token is received within a configurable timeout window (typically 500 ms), the module drives each channel to a pre-configured fail-safe state — either hold-last-value or drive-to-zero — depending on the HPM configuration database entry for that point.

The PCB layout routes analog output traces away from the digital clock lines using a split ground plane strategy, reducing capacitive coupling that would otherwise introduce high-frequency noise onto the 4–20 mA loop. Bulk decoupling capacitors at the backplane connector suppress power-rail transients generated by adjacent modules during hot-swap insertion events, protecting the DAC reference from momentary supply dips that would cause output glitches visible to downstream field devices.

System Integration Benefits

  • Zero-reconfiguration slot replacement: The MU-TAOY22 is recognized by the HPM/APM controller via its module ID register; swapping a failed card with a spare of the same part number requires no database modification, reducing mean time to repair (MTTR) to the physical card swap time alone.
  • Deterministic output update latency: Output setpoints are transmitted over the I/O Link bus within a single controller execution cycle (typically 500 ms or 1 s, depending on HPM configuration), ensuring that PID loop output changes reach the field device without additional software-layer delays.
  • Fail-safe output behavior: Each channel’s fail-safe state is individually configurable in the TPS engineering database, allowing process engineers to define whether a valve should close, hold position, or open on loss of controller communication — a critical requirement for safety-instrumented process loops.
  • Diagnostic transparency via UCN: The module reports channel-level diagnostics — including open-loop detection (load resistance above threshold), output saturation, and internal DAC fault — back to the operator console via the Universal Control Network (UCN), enabling maintenance personnel to identify field wiring faults without physical inspection of the marshalling cabinet.
  • Hot-swap capable chassis design: The TPS HPM chassis supports live card insertion and removal; the MU-TAOY22 drives its outputs to the configured fail-safe state during extraction and resumes normal operation within one scan cycle after re-insertion, minimizing process disturbance during maintenance windows.
  • Backward compatibility with TDC 3000 infrastructure: The module operates identically in both TPS HPM and legacy TDC 3000 APM chassis, protecting capital investment in existing marshalling cabinets, FTA panels, and field wiring when upgrading from TDC 3000 to TPS architecture.
  • Reduced field wiring cost: The 750 Ω maximum load specification accommodates standard 0.5 mm² twisted-pair cable over runs exceeding 300 m, eliminating the need for signal boosters or intermediate junction amplifiers in large-footprint plant layouts.
  • Consistent output accuracy across thermal cycles: The precision DAC reference and low-drift V/I converter maintain ±0.1% full-scale accuracy from 0 °C to 60 °C without field recalibration, reducing scheduled maintenance burden in installations subject to seasonal ambient temperature variation.
